

# UpdateResolverType
<a name="API_UpdateResolverType"></a>

Updates the resolver type for a case.

**Important**  
This operation only supports changing a case from Self-managed to AWS-supported resolution. Once a case is changed to AWS-supported, it cannot be changed back to Self-managed.

## Request Syntax
<a name="API_UpdateResolverType_RequestSyntax"></a>

```
POST /v1/cases/caseId/update-resolver-type HTTP/1.1
Content-type: application/json

{
   "resolverType": "string"
}
```

## URI Request Parameters
<a name="API_UpdateResolverType_RequestParameters"></a>

The request uses the following URI parameters.

 ** [caseId](#API_UpdateResolverType_RequestSyntax) **   <a name="securityir-UpdateResolverType-request-uri-caseId"></a>
Required element for UpdateResolverType to identify the case to update.  
Length Constraints: Minimum length of 10. Maximum length of 32.  
Pattern: `\d{10,32}.*`   
Required: Yes

## Request Body
<a name="API_UpdateResolverType_RequestBody"></a>

The request accepts the following data in JSON format.

 ** [resolverType](#API_UpdateResolverType_RequestSyntax) **   <a name="securityir-UpdateResolverType-request-resolverType"></a>
Required element for UpdateResolverType to identify the new resolver.  
Valid values are `AWS` (for AWS-supported) or `Self` (for Self-managed). Note that you can only transition from Self-managed to AWS-supported. Attempting to change an AWS-supported case to Self-managed will result in an error.  
Type: String  
Valid Values: `AWS | Self`   
Required: Yes

## Response Syntax
<a name="API_UpdateResolverType_ResponseSyntax"></a>

```
HTTP/1.1 200
Content-type: application/json

{
   "caseId": "string",
   "caseStatus": "string",
   "resolverType": "string"
}
```

## Response Elements
<a name="API_UpdateResolverType_ResponseElements"></a>

If the action is successful, the service sends back an HTTP 200 response.

The following data is returned in JSON format by the service.

 ** [caseId](#API_UpdateResolverType_ResponseSyntax) **   <a name="securityir-UpdateResolverType-response-caseId"></a>
Response element for UpdateResolver identifying the case ID being updated.  
Type: String  
Length Constraints: Minimum length of 10. Maximum length of 32.  
Pattern: `\d{10,32}.*` 

 ** [caseStatus](#API_UpdateResolverType_ResponseSyntax) **   <a name="securityir-UpdateResolverType-response-caseStatus"></a>
Response element for UpdateResolver identifying the current status of the case.  
Type: String  
Valid Values: `Submitted | Acknowledged | Detection and Analysis | Containment, Eradication and Recovery | Post-incident Activities | Ready to Close | Closed` 

 ** [resolverType](#API_UpdateResolverType_ResponseSyntax) **   <a name="securityir-UpdateResolverType-response-resolverType"></a>
Response element for UpdateResolver identifying the current resolver of the case.  
This value will be `AWS` after a successful transition from Self-managed to AWS-supported.  
Type: String  
Valid Values: `AWS | Self` 

## Errors
<a name="API_UpdateResolverType_Errors"></a>

For information about the errors that are common to all actions, see [Common Error Types](CommonErrors.md).

 ** AccessDeniedException **   
    
 ** message **   
The ID of the resource which lead to the access denial. 
HTTP Status Code: 403

 ** ConflictException **   
Returned when there is a conflict with the current state of the resource.  
For UpdateResolverType, this error may occur when attempting to change an AWS-supported case to Self-managed, which is not supported.    
 ** message **   
The exception message.  
 ** resourceId **   
The ID of the conflicting resource.  
 ** resourceType **   
The type of the conflicting resource.
HTTP Status Code: 409
